Yuma Uchida, born on September 21, 1992, is a prominent Japanese voice actor and singer who has become one of the most recognizable talents in the anime industry. Represented by the agency Intention, Uchida has built an impressive career defined by his versatility in voicing a wide range of characters, from brooding heroes to energetic protagonists. He is best known for his roles as Megumi Fushiguro in Jujutsu Kaisen, Kawaki in Boruto: Naruto Next Generations, and Ash Lynx in Banana Fish, as well as Haruka Sakura in Wind Breaker and Reo Mikage in Blue Lock. His commanding voice and emotional depth have earned him a dedicated fanbase both in Japan and internationally.
Uchida’s journey into voice acting began after he graduated from high school, when he decided to pursue a career in entertainment. He made his debut in the early 2010s, with his first major role coming as Yuuma Kousaka in Gundam Build Fighters Try in 2014. This led to a series of significant parts in the following years, including Nagisa Kiry? in Classroom Crisis, Ein Dalton in Mobile Suit Gundam: Iron-Blooded Orphans, and Hayate Immelmann in Macross Delta. His work in The Idolmaster SideM as Kaoru Sakuraba and in Ensemble Stars!! as Jun Sazanami also showcased his ability to bring energy and charisma to idol-themed projects. By 2017, his rapid rise was recognized when he received the 11th Seiyu Awards for Best Male Newcomer, sharing the honor with Setsuo It? and Yusuke Kobayashi.
Uchida’s career reached new heights in 2018 when he voiced the tragic and complex Ash Lynx in Banana Fish, a performance that drew critical acclaim for its raw emotional intensity. That same year, he made his singing debut under King Records, releasing his first single in May 2018. His music career quickly gained traction, and he began performing at live events and releasing albums that blended pop and rock influences. In 2019, he won Best Male Lead Actor at the 13th Seiyu Awards, cementing his status as a leading voice in the industry. He continued to land high-profile roles, including Iori Kitahara in Grand Blue, Kyo Sohma in the 2019 reboot of Fruits Basket, and Eishir? Yabuki in The Asterisk War.
In recent years, Uchida has become synonymous with some of the most popular anime franchises of the decade. His portrayal of Megumi Fushiguro in Jujutsu Kaisen has been particularly celebrated, as the series became a global phenomenon. He also voices Kawaki, a pivotal character in Boruto: Naruto Next Generations, and Reo Mikage in the hit sports anime Blue Lock. His role as Haruka Sakura in Wind Breaker further demonstrates his range in action-oriented series. Beyond anime, Uchida has contributed to video game voice work and continues to release music, performing at major anime conventions and concerts.
